Hi Grant,

any METAL case will work.  What you create is a Faraday cage, that will 
eliminate electrostatic and electromagnetic influence. However,  it will NOT 
eliminate static magnetic fields, nor low frequency electromagnetic waves. 
In such a case you'll need ferro materials,  one of the best being so 
called mu metal.  But, as your question was about RF, pewter will work, not 
as good as ferro materials, but it depends on the pewter wall thickness.  In 
many modern electronics, you get acceptable RF shielding by means of plastic 
boxes with a thin metal coating only. Works for weak RF signals, which are 
often the case within commercial products like mobile telephones and 
transistor radios.  Speaking RF signals at radar levels,  magnetrons, 
klystrons,  TWTs and other high power sources,  I would not use pewter.
